Climate-controlled storage units maintain a consistent temperature and humidity level year-round. Unlike standard units, these spaces are designed to protect sensitive items from extreme weather changes.
Typically, these units stay between 55°F and 80°F, reducing the risk of warping, cracking, mold, and mildew.
Easton experiences all four seasons—hot, humid summers and cold, dry winters. These fluctuations can be tough on stored items.
A climate-controlled unit eliminates these risks entirely.
